Abstract

The torch altar lamp which burns day and night combustion state detection device based on ion circuit that the utility model is related to a kind of, including altar lamp burner, metal probe, conducting wire and flame ionic detector, the altar lamp burner is metalwork, described metal probe one end reaches the top of altar lamp burner, and in the flame generated when positioned at altar lamp burner combustion, the metal probe other end is connected by one end of conducting wire and flame ionic detector, and the altar lamp burner is connected by the other end of conducting wire and flame ionic detector.When altar lamp is ignited, there is flame combustion, flame generates ion circuit, metal probe and altar lamp burner constitute ion circuit by flame combustion, entire circuit conducting, flame ionic detector illustrate that flame is burning after detecting composition circuit, no flame combustion are illustrated if no circuit, by this device, it is whether kept burning day and night that flame can be detected.Compared with prior art, the utility model is simple in structure, at low cost, easy to detect.

Background technology
In many chemical plant installations, all there are one torches, are used for burning waste gas, prevent exhaust emission environment.And it is long as torch Bright lamp must 24 hours exhaust gas for working to cope with to discharge at any time light, the requirement to torch altar lamp which burns day and night monitoring in this way is very high ?.The prior art is the temperature using thermocouple measurement torch altar lamp which burns day and night, when temperature is less than setting value, is considered as torch and puts out It goes out.But thermocouple requirement is higher, is easy to make thermocouple break in the case of torch high temperature low temperature for a moment for a moment, and In torch operation, thermocouple can not be replaced online, as long as so thermocouple damage is equivalent to using detection altar lamp State, it is extremely dangerous.
Infrared, ultraviolet optics monitoring means, which exists, is easily asked by weather interference, indistinguishable multiple altar lamp combustion states Topic.
Chinese patent CN105910106A discloses a kind of torch burning state optical fiber monitoring device, including optical fiber, optical fiber Upper end be connected with fibre-optical probe, fibre-optical probe is arranged in altar lamp, and the top of altar lamp is equipped with signal enhancing plate, optical fiber Lower end be connected with fiber-optic signal converter, the side of altar lamp is provided with Cauldron burner.Fibre-optical probe is set as to fire The probe that flame is observed;Optical fiber is set as the optical fiber of transmission signal;Signal enhancing plate be set as enhancing fibre-optical probe acquisition signal and Increased one piece of metallic plate at the top of altar lamp;Altar lamp is the equipment kept burning day and night ignited the Cauldron;Fiber-optic signal converter is set as Fiber-optic signal is converted into logic judgment signal or controls the processor of signal;It is useless that Cauldron burner is set as Petrochemical Enterprises processing The mix flare burner of gas;Flame is set as the flame generated during altar lamp and Cauldron burner combustion.When altar lamp burns When, since flame emits beam frequency band signals, after fibre-optical probe detects this signal, fiber-optic signal is transferred to by optical fiber and is turned Parallel operation, fiber-optic signal converter judge that altar lamp is sent out there is currently flame status is in the signal of combustion state to control room. After altar lamp extinguishes due to various reasons, the optical fiber frequency band signals that flame is sent out disappear, and fibre-optical probe can not be tested kept burning day and night Lamp burns the light signal that sends out, and fiber-optic signal converter sends out the extinct signal of flame to control room, control room root at this time Firing action or alarm are sent out according to this signal.The light frequency band signals that above-mentioned patent is sent out based on flame, by detecting this One signal judges combustion state, but the above method is equally easily interfered by weather, and multiple altar lamp combustion states cannot be distinguished The problem of.
Utility model content
The purpose of this utility model be exactly in order to overcome the problems of the above-mentioned prior art and provide it is a kind of it is simple in structure, Detection is accurate, is not easy the torch altar lamp which burns day and night combustion state detection device based on ion circuit being disturbed.
The purpose of this utility model can be achieved through the following technical solutions:
A kind of torch altar lamp which burns day and night combustion state detection device based on ion circuit, including altar lamp burner, metal probe, Conducting wire and flame ionic detector, the altar lamp burner are metalwork, and described metal probe one end reaches altar lamp burner Top, and be located in the flame generated when altar lamp burner combustion, the metal probe other end passes through conducting wire and flame ion One end of detector connects, and the altar lamp burner is connected by the other end of conducting wire and flame ionic detector.
The flame ionic detector sends out different instructions or state when being disconnected from circuit when circuit is connected.
The flame ionic detector is useful for the interface being connect with anode and cathode.
It is enclosed with insulator outside the metal probe.
The insulator is arranged in parallel with altar lamp burner.
Compared with prior art, the utility model has the following advantages and advantageous effect:
1, the utility model is simple in structure, only needs a refractory metal probe, securely and reliably.
2, a conducting wire is drawn in metal probe end, some small voltages, the voltage on the conducting wire are added on conducting wire Sent out by flame ionic detector, ion detector can just measure back either with or without voltage to determine whether break-make, flame whether there is or not, It is formed into a loop with the altar lamp burner of metal itself.
3, by the present apparatus, fire resisting probe structure is simple, only a metal probe, it is not easy to it is damaged by flame combustion, It is almost non-maintaining after mounting.
